S759 CNV is a 1998 Saab 9-3 SE Tid in Blue with a 2,171c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 17 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 58.8%.

Across all 1998 Saab 9-3 SE Tid models, the average MOT pass rate is 67.5% with a typical mileage of 137,574 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Saab 9-3 SE Tid f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 227 recorded failures. If you're considering buying S759 CNV,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Saab 9-3 SE Tid typically stays on UK roads for around 28 years. At 28 years old, this Saab 9-3 SE Tid is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
